engine

Post by toysuzi »

if ur keeping it diesel id go a sufr 3.0l turbo around 100kw

ur engine puts out 56kw @ 4200 160nm @ 2400

if ur wanting petrol id go the 4.0l all alloy v8 toyota you can pick up engine packs (engine comp + wire harness) from around $2000.00

4litre 1uz-fe 191kw @ 5400rpm / 353nm @ 4600rpm

4litre 1uz-fe vvti 206 @ 6000rpm / 402nm @ 4000rpm

4.2litre 3uz-fe vvti 206kw @ 5600rpm / 430nm @ 3400rpm

landcruser 4.7litre 173kw @ 5600rpm / 422nm @ 3600

5.0l 1gz-fe vvti 206kw @ 5200rpm / 481nm @ 4000rpm

vn v6 125kw / vp 127kw / vr 130kw later 132kw/ vs ecotec 147kw


id say the toyota v8 is the go.if going petrol just look at the specs.

hope that helps u out. & good luck

Post by suprasurf »

I think the BBS needs a Lux engine swap sticky :)

I always end up harping on about the Supra swap whenever someone is looking to power up a Lux.

For bugga all $$$ you can drop a 5M (2.8) or 7M (3.0) straight 6 into a Lux. Because the old Supras are cheap to buy and the motor bolts straight up to the Lux box you can get one in the hole for under $1000 including engine !

Do some searching for 5M ( or 5M-GE ) 4runner swaps and you should get the info you need. Also research other options, V6 Commo and 1UZ and both good swaps.

Post by CRWLNLUX »

I am currently putting a 1uzfe into my 1993 surf. I bought the 1uz for $2000 in a half cut. The V8 bolted straight to the original hilux gearbox which is the auto (A343F) which was a suprise. I trial fitted the motor the motor on the weekend and found that the back right of the sump hit on the front diff, otherwise everything is fits well. I plan to either modify the sump or install a 4inch ifs lift kit which drops the front diff. Or do a solid axle conversion which would solve all problems.
